Structural Foundations: Designing for Capacity and Functionality
Creating a garage worthy of fine automobiles begins with fundamental structural choices that will determine the space’s capabilities and limitations.
Size and Layout Considerations
The dimensions of your custom garage should accommodate not just the number of vehicles you currently own, but allow room for future acquisitions. Our experience has shown that most serious collectors eventually expand their collections, making flexibility critical. We typically recommend a minimum of 600-800 square feet for a four-car garage, with additional space if you plan to incorporate a workshop, lounge, or storage areas.
Ceiling height deserves careful consideration, particularly for collectors with exotic or specialty vehicles. While standard garages offer 8-foot ceilings, we recommend a minimum of 12 feet for luxury garages. This additional height accommodates vehicle lifts (which require approximately 11-12 feet of clearance), allows for overhead storage systems, and creates a more spacious, impressive atmosphere. Several of our most striking projects feature dramatic vaulted ceilings that transform the garage into a true showroom environment.
Door selection significantly impacts both functionality and aesthetics. For multi-car garages, individual doors offer greater flexibility than a single larger door, allowing access to specific vehicles without exposing the entire collection to the elements. We offer a range of custom door options, from traditional carriage-house designs to contemporary glass doors that showcase your collection from the exterior, each carefully integrated with the home’s architectural style.
Specialized Flooring Solutions
Flooring selection is crucial for both the protection of your vehicles and the overall appearance of your garage. Polished concrete with decorative epoxy coatings has become increasingly popular among collectors for its durability, stain resistance, and sophisticated appearance. These surfaces can be customized with logos, racing stripes, or complementary color schemes that enhance the presentation of your vehicles.
For the ultimate in luxury garage flooring, we offer modular tile systems specifically engineered for automotive environments. These interlocking tiles provide superior chemical resistance, excellent traction even when wet, and come in a variety of colors and patterns that can be arranged to create distinctive designs. The subtle cushioning these systems provide also reduces fatigue during extended time in the garage and offers some protection against dropped tools or parts.
Climate Control and Environmental Protection: Preserving Your Investment
Protecting valuable vehicles requires careful attention to environmental factors that can affect automotive finishes, interiors, and mechanical components.
Temperature and Humidity Management
Consistent climate control is essential for preserving vehicles, particularly classics or exotics with sensitive materials and finishes. Our custom garages typically incorporate dedicated HVAC systems separate from the main house, allowing precise temperature and humidity management. For collections including leather-trimmed classics or vintage convertibles, maintaining humidity between 40-50% prevents leather cracking and fabric deterioration.
In regions with extreme seasonal variations, supplemental heating options such as in-floor radiant systems provide even, gentle heat that’s ideal for automotive environments. These systems warm the vehicles from below, preventing cold-start issues during winter months while maintaining comfortable working temperatures for the enthusiast.
Air Quality and Filtration Systems
Dust control represents another critical consideration for serious collectors. Our luxury garages often include specialized air filtration systems that capture airborne particles before they can settle on vehicle surfaces. For working garages where detailing or minor maintenance occurs, we recommend positive pressure systems that prevent dust infiltration when doors are opened.
For clients with adjoining living spaces, exhaust extraction systems ensure that vehicle emissions don’t enter the home environment. These systems can be designed as retractable units that remain hidden when not in use, preserving the garage’s clean aesthetic while providing functionality when needed.
Beyond Storage: Creating a True Enthusiast’s Environment
The most exceptional custom garages transcend basic vehicle storage to become extensions of the home’s living space and reflections of the owner’s automotive passion.
Integrated Workspaces and Detailing Areas
For hands-on enthusiasts, incorporating a dedicated workspace transforms a garage from passive storage into an active enjoyment center. Custom tool storage, workbenches with durable surfaces, and specialized equipment placement can be thoughtfully integrated without compromising the garage’s refined appearance. We often design these elements with high-end cabinetry that complements the garage’s overall aesthetic while providing practical functionality.
Dedicated detailing areas with water connections, drainage, and proper lighting allow for convenient vehicle care without the need to relocate cars. These specialized zones can include pressure washer connections, hot water supply, and chemical-resistant surfaces to facilitate everything from quick rinses to comprehensive detailing sessions.
Entertainment and Display Elements
Many of our clients view their garages as social spaces for sharing their passion with like-minded enthusiasts. Incorporating seating areas, entertainment systems, and refreshment centers creates an environment for hosting car club meetings or simply enjoying the collection with friends. These elements can be designed to complement the automotive theme or provide sophisticated contrast to the technical nature of the vehicles.
Thoughtful lighting design dramatically enhances both the functionality and presentation of your collection. A combination of ambient lighting for general illumination, accent lighting to highlight specific vehicles, and task lighting for work areas creates a flexible environment that can shift from practical space to dramatic showcase with simple adjustments. LED systems with programmable controls allow you to create different lighting scenarios for various uses of the space.
